Newly launched classes: Beast Master Hunter - A few big changes to Hunters. First off, steady shot not clipping auto shot made the class much easier to model. In terms of itemization the big change is the talent Careful aim now giving intellect one AP per point. Also, there were big changes to pets, and you can now select the relevant pet talents for Ferocity. Enhancement Shaman - Lots of changes here as well. Flametongue is now viable with certain setups especially when the new spell Lava Lash is considered. The Maelstrom Weapon talent allowing for instant Lightning Bolts also spices up the class. Stat Changes: - Between healing changing to spell power and the consolidation of spell hit and hit, spell crit and crit, and spell haste and haste, alot of changes have been made to items. I think I've successfully changed all of my models and items to reflect these changes, however if you notice any weirdness with some of the rankings on items with new stats, please let me know! - Nuuga |

The patch everyone has been eagerly awaiting is finally here! I've been extremely busy updating the talents and models for many classes in preperation for this patch, and also for the expansion which will be released in less than one month. Here's a list of the classes fully updated for 3.0.2 including talents, ablities, rotations and buffs: Fury Warrior - Huge changes here. I've implemented a full rage model with Heroic Strike as the rage dump and an optional Execute after 20% option. I think this is much more accurate now. Based on a Bloodthirst, Whirlwind rotation with Instant Slams thrown in on Bloodthurst crits with Bloodsurge talented. And of course, Titan's Grip! Arms Warrior - Like fury warrior, a full rage model has been implemented. Currently modeled assuming the warrior is staying in Battle Stance and using overpower on dodges and taste for blood procs, and Executes on Sudden Death procs. There will be further changes to this model as Blizzard has stated some things will change. Retribution Paladin - Wow, massive buffs for ret pallies in this expansion. Added the news seals and added Consecration and Divine Storm to the dps rotation. Affliction Warlock - Added Haunt to the rotation. With the new talents this class will finally be a viable raiding spec. Fire Mage - Added Living Bomb and Instant Pyroblasts on Hot Streak procs to rotation. Frost Mage - For awhile it was looking like Ice Lance may be added to the rotation, but now it's just a standard rotation with instant Fireballs on Brain Freeze procs (increases dps and mana efficiency slightly). Shadow Priest - All new talents added. Blizzard recently said they will be getting a buff to DPS soon, so keep an eye out.
